Customer Requested Standard Software Enhancements and/or Custom Software
1. Definition
We will provide you requested standard software enhancements and/or custom software services as discussed below.
You agree to cooperate in limiting the scope of those modifications and enhancements, as described below.
An analysis and assessment to verify the scope of effort for these services will be conducted. A revised estimate for the
enhancements/customizations may be provided at the conclusion of the assessment.You may elect to cancel or proceed
with the enhancements/customizations based on the revised estimate.
Capabilities included in the initial scope:
a) Custom Software/Interface(s)
While we will provide reasonable consultation, you are responsible for obtaining
technical contacts and/or technical specifications from the third parties involved.
(1) Central Square CAD to CAD Hub
This is an addendum to add 4 new CAD agencies to the current Tyler
CAD-to-CAD interface with Central Square Technologies (CST) Unify
HUB_ Scope to include the following:
• Setup Round Rock's Tyler TEST environment for CST Unify
HUB CAD-to-CAD.
• Configure/Test Tyler CAD-to-CAD interface with 5 agencies
using the TEST CST Unify HUB in the Cloud.
• This testing will use the interface version currently installed in
Round Rock's PROD environment_ There will be no
programming changes made as part of this implementation.
• Once all 5 agencies have completed testing the interface it will
be moved to Production.
• Any programming changes requested during testing will be
billable under a new, separate contract and implemented at a
later date.
2. Methodology to Provide Enhancements and/or Custom Software
a) Our Responsibility
Exhibit 1
Schedule 1
As part of our delivery of these services,we will:
(1) Review the required features for the items set forth in paragraph 1, above,with you.
(2) Prepare a Requirements Document(RD)to include:
• Detailed description of the required feature
• menu samples
• screen samples
• report samples
(3) Conduct the programming and programming test.
(4) Provide the associated in-scope training,testing and/or other support services.
For an enhancement or custom software requiring over seven (7) days of services, we will utilize the design
document procedure described below. For enhancements or custom software that require less than seven
(7) days of services, we will use a Request For Service (RFS) procedure. Both procedures are reviewed with
you at a pre-installation planning meeting. The RFS procedure utilizes a form with a narrative description
and supporting documentation if applicable to define the work to be done.
